| Staying Healthy Now to be Ready for the Future
Many of the 6 million Americans living with paralysis are waiting for a cure or looking for some way to improve their quality of life. While there is an increasing excitement over clinical trials beginning in the United States, and discussions of transplant therapies taking place in other countries, understanding who is a candidate for these trials continues to be a question in the forefront of the minds of those seeking a cure. How do individuals stay healthy in preparation for participation in clinical trials? Maintaining health is crucial to considering participation in clinical trials. As scientific
advances come to light, individuals with spinal cord injury need to understand how to maintain their health to be ready to participate. This month’s lecture will discuss an individual’s responsibility as a potential candidate and
explore resources available now to help individuals with spinal cord injury live a healthy life.

Audience
The Stepping Forward - Staying Informed Lecture Series is designed as an educational opportunity for individuals living with spinal cord injuries, their family members, and healthcare professionals working in or with an interest in the field of spinal cord injury. Each lecture presenter tailors their presentation to the needs of the audience, using language that is understood by those without a medical or scientific background. |
